This section covers the mechanics of playing online casino games specifically within Ontario’s regulated market — how games actually work, how the reading experience differs across devices, and how to get through an operator’s terms and conditions without missing the part that matters. It exists as its own category rather than folding into general casino coverage because Ontario’s market runs on rules the rest of Canada doesn’t share: every operator here is registered through iGaming Ontario and bound to the AGCO’s Registrar’s Standards, so the practical questions readers ask — is this bonus actually worth claiming, does this game behave differently on a phone, what should I check before I deposit — have Ontario-specific answers.
